Long Island Class B girls’ championship: No. 11 Manhasset tops Eastport-South Manor, 11-7

06/03/2013 By TopLaxRecruits Leave a Comment

By Jaclynkelli Kronemberg
TopLaxRecruits.com, Posted 6/3/13

GARDEN CITY, N.Y. – Natalie Stefan scored four goals to propel the Manhasset girls’ lacrosse team to an 11-7 victory of Eastport-South Manor Sunday in the Class B Long Island Championship game at Adelphi University.

Manhasset celebrates the LI girls’ Class B championship

Manhasset (16-3), ranked No. 11 by TopLaxrecruits.com, will face Section 5 champion Brighton (17-3) in the state semifinals Friday at Cortland State at noon.

“This feels unreal, it kind of feels like a dream,” said Stefan. “We give it 100 percent in practice, we give it 100 percent on the field and it has paid off. I think going forward, if we keep doing what we are doing there is no team we can’t beat.”

Manhasset scored two goals late in the first half to seize a 4-3 lead and later Stefan scored her fourth goal at the 20:44 mark to make it 6-4. Kellen D’Alleva made it 7-4 and Julia Glynn’s second tally gave the Indians their largest lead, 10-6, with 2:51 left in the game.

Glynn finished with three goals and one assist and Emily Koufakis and Sarah Barcia each added one goal and one assist for Manhasset. Erin Coleman made six saves in goal.

Natalie Stefan

“This feels great; the kids definitely worked for hard for this,” said Manhasset head coach Danielle Gallagher. “We rode a little bit of a rollercoaster today.

“We went with our zone (defense), which has worked against a lot of really good teams this year. But it didn’t work against them. They were doing a great job at keeping it coming at us hard so we changed things up, adjusted and that ended up working out for us.

“I know it’s not going to be easy but I think the games we played throughout the season have prepared us for every tough opponent we are going to face.”

Dakota Mason led the Sharks (15-5) with three goals and Marissa Gurello and Kaeli Huff both scored one goal and had one assist each.

“We fought hard,” said Eastport-South Manor coach Becky Thorn. “My defense is one of the top defenses in Suffolk County and they came out here with heart, but Manhasset crushed us on attack today.”

Manhasset 11, Eastport South Manor 7

Manhasset 4-7-11
Eastport-South Manor 3-4-7

M: Natalie Stefan 4G; Julia Glynn 3G, 1A; Sarah Barcia 1G, 1A; Emily Koufakis 1G, 1A; Kathryn Hallet 1G, Kellen D’Alleva 1G; Sarah Phillips 1A; Erin Barry 1A

ESM:
Dakota Mason 3G; Marissa Gurello 1G, 1A; Kaeli Huff 1G, 1A; Kristin Anderson 1G; Jacqueline Wasilko 1G

Saves:
Erin Coleman (M) 6; Sam Giacolone (ESM) 7
